Fermentation Industry-Overview

  • The Fermentation Industry produces antibiotics, amino acids, enzymes, polymers, vitamins, steroids, organic acids, ETOH, bio-pesticides, yeast and various ferments

  • The production of biological active substances by means of culture of microbes require a broad medium including, organic nitrogen, carbohydrates, vitamins, minerals, etc

  • Products likes starch, glucose, sorbitol, wheat gluten, corn steep, potato proteins, are bio-converted and used for the preparation of ever large numbers of intermediate products

  • Genetic engineering by means of fermentation, has created another generation of valuable substances like insulin, interferon, growth hormones, new seed varieties which extends the range of products out of fermentation activities.

  • The modifications and the alterations of the culture conditions highly depends on the culture media

  • The Fermentation Industry serves as the intermediary industry for sectors like food and animal foodstuffs, pharmaceuticals, and agriculture

FDI Inflows to Fermentation Industries-yearly

  • In the year 2003, the number of approval was 85, out of which 23 were technical and 62 were financial, the amount of Foreign Direct Investments (FDI) approved was ` 20801.72 million and the percentage of contribution towards total FDI was 0.73 %

  • In the year 2004, the number of approval was 58, out of which 17 were technical and 41 were financial, the amount of FDI approved was ` 11255.13 million and the percentage of contribution towards total FDI was 0.62 %
